Transaction ed7a792686b619b724023942c684ff1bf72515f70154d3e0094d88473e086e59
1 Input
2 Outputs
- ed7a792686b619b724023942c684ff1bf72515f70154d3e0094d88473e086e59:0
- ed7a792686b619b724023942c684ff1bf72515f70154d3e0094d88473e086e59:1
value 34100000
address 1CE9eo1zjAAuMfGjGmTL95Wdf3dHWbCt7T
value 9860518
address 18hgNfH7ghdMXMoknvacHfRJtBHgUG6Yjw